+/// Rounding mode.
+///
+/// Enumerates supported rounding modes, as well as some special values. The set
+/// of the modes must agree with IEEE-754, 4.3.1 and 4.3.2. The constants
+/// assigned to the IEEE rounding modes must agree with the values used by
+/// FLT_ROUNDS (C11, 5.2.4.2.2p8).
+///
+/// This value is packed into bitfield in some cases, including \c FPOptions, so
+/// the rounding mode values and the special value \c Dynamic must fit into the
+/// the bit field (now - 3 bits). The value \c Invalid is used only in values
+/// returned by intrinsics to indicate errors, it should never be stored as
+/// rounding mode value, so it does not need to fit the bit fields.
+///
+enum class RoundingMode : int8_t {
+ // Rounding mode defined in IEEE-754.
+ TowardZero = 0, ///< roundTowardZero.
+ NearestTiesToEven = 1, ///< roundTiesToEven.
+ TowardPositive = 2, ///< roundTowardPositive.
+ TowardNegative = 3, ///< roundTowardNegative.
+ NearestTiesToAway = 4, ///< roundTiesToAway.
+
+ // Special values.
+ Dynamic = 7, ///< Denotes mode unknown at compile time.
+ Invalid = -1 ///< Denotes invalid value.
+};

+/// Represent subnormal handling kind for floating point instruction inputs and
+/// outputs.
+struct DenormalMode {
+ /// Represent handled modes for denormal (aka subnormal) modes in the floating
+ /// point environment.
+ enum DenormalModeKind : int8_t {
+ Invalid = -1,
+
+ /// IEEE-754 denormal numbers preserved.
+ IEEE,
+
+ /// The sign of a flushed-to-zero number is preserved in the sign of 0
+ PreserveSign,
+
+ /// Denormals are flushed to positive zero.
+ PositiveZero
+ };
+
+ /// Denormal flushing mode for floating point instruction results in the
+ /// default floating point environment.
+ DenormalModeKind Output = DenormalModeKind::Invalid;
+
+ /// Denormal treatment kind for floating point instruction inputs in the
+ /// default floating-point environment. If this is not DenormalModeKind::IEEE,
+ /// floating-point instructions implicitly treat the input value as 0.
+ DenormalModeKind Input = DenormalModeKind::Invalid;
